Property Details for 9 Monroe Pl, Mcdowall

9 Monroe Pl, Mcdowall is a 5 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2000. The property has a land size of 784m2 and floor size of 161m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

About Mcdowall 4053

The size of Mcdowall is approximately 4.2 square kilometres. It has 15 parks covering nearly 25.7% of total area. The population of Mcdowall in 2011 was 6,818 people. By 2016 the population was 7,228 showing a population growth of 6.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mcdowall is 40-49 years. Households in Mcdowall are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mcdowall work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 80.7% of the homes in Mcdowall were owner-occupied compared with 78.3% in 2016.

Mcdowall has 3,203 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Mcdowall have seen a 83.43%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 86.02%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Mcdowall is $1,237,568 while the median value for Units is $776,229.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750 while Units have a median rent of $675.
There are currently 19 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Mcdowall on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 156 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Mcdowall.
